Deputy Head of Maths job summary
We are looking for an excellent Maths specialist to come and develop as leader in the
Maths department. This is an ideal opportunity to flourish in an engaging and innovative
environment that will help you develop as a teacher and leader. It would be ideal for
someone looking towards a Head of Maths role or senior leadership and we have
excellent and successful leadership development programmes. We are proud of all that
students achieve at St Paul’s and this led to us being awarded High Performing Schools
Status. The last nationally published 2019 results were:
• GCSE: 82% 9-4 with English and Maths and a progress 8 score in the top 10% nationally.
• A2: 60% A*-B and 88% A*-C. This is an ALPS rating of ‘excellent” over the last three years.
• Over 1 in 4 students have gone on to study at Russell Group universities. This year 81% of
students were offered places at their first choice university

St Paul’s is an outstanding 11-18 mixed Catholic comprehensive school with a total of 1120 students on roll, including 270 students in the Sixth form. The College has a strong ethos and is a vibrant Christian community. We are committed to making sure we never accept second best for the students in our care and look to give them a full experience of education that supports their academic, personal and faith development.
This is summarised in our mission statement and educational vision which is:
“To provide an innovative, inspirational and Christian education which challenges, nurtures and informs our students to enable them to take their place in a changing world.”
